题目描述:给定一个字符串在字符串中找到第一个连续出现至少k次的字符。输入:第一行包含一个正整数k表示至少需要连续出现的次数。1<=k<=1000。第二行包含需要查找的字符串。字符串长度在1到1000之间且不包含任何空白字符。输出:若存在连续出现至少k次的字符输出第一个满足条件的字符;否则输出No。样例1:输入3abcccaaab样例1:输出C
代码如下:
k = int(input()) s = input()
count = 1 for i in range(1, len(s)): if s[i] == s[i-1]: count += 1 if count >= k: print(s[i]) break else: count = 1 else: print("No")
原文地址: http://www.cveoy.top/t/topic/ifHz 著作权归作者所有。请勿转载和采集!